power: supply: max17042_battery: Put LSB units into defines

#define MAX17042_VMAX_TOLERANCE 50 /* 50 mV */
|
||||
|
||||
#define MAX17042_CURRENT_LSB 1562500ll /* 1.5625µV/Rsense */
|
||||
#define MAX17042_CAPACITY_LSB 5000000ll /* 5.0µVH/Rsense */
|
||||
#define MAX17042_TIME_LSB 5625 / 1000 /* s */
|
||||
#define MAX17042_VOLTAGE_LSB 625 / 8 /* µV */
|
||||
#define MAX17042_RESISTANCE_LSB 1 / 4096 /* Ω */
|
||||
#define MAX17042_TEMPERATURE_LSB 1 / 256 /* °C */
